David Garza will be the new Executive Director of Henry Street Settlement, effective July 1, 2010.Garza, currently Chief Administrator of Henry Street’s Workforce Development Center (WDC), is succeeding Verona Middleton-Jeter who is retiring after 38 years at the Settlement, seven of them as Executive Director. Garza began at the WDC in July 2001 and became its Chief Administrator in 2005. Prior to joining Henry Street, he worked as a retail management executive and an independent producer for film, television and corporate marketing projects. “David’s success in building the WDC into one of the city’s preeminent centers and his deep understanding of the Henry Street community will serve the agency well going forward,” said Robert Harrison, Chairman of Henry Street’s Board of Directors, which elected Garza at its February 22, 2010, meeting following a six-month national search. Dale Burch, Henry Street Board President, lauded David’s passion for the agency and his ability to motivate and inspire. “Today, the services Henry Street provides are more vital than ever,” said Garza. “I am honored and quite thrilled with the opportunity to build on the Settlement’s remarkable legacy as we move into the future.” Ms. Middleton-Jeter, said, “I know that I’m leaving Henry Street in good hands; I’m confident that David will excel at leading the Settlement in the years ahead.” Garza graduated from Harvard College in 1986 and later from the Institute for Not-for-Profit Management at Columbia Business School. |
